In the Face of the Ebola Epidemic, the World Health Organization Recommends Measures of Social Distancing in the DRC

Summary by Le Temps
On Monday, the World Health Organization issued recommendations for health measures in the Democratic Republic of the Congo. It recommends social distancing and monitoring of mobility in the face of the spread of the Ebola epidemic, the World Health Organization (WHO) recommended on Monday that the Democratic Republic of the Congo (DRC) take measures to distancise and monitor mobility in the face of the spread of the Ebola epidemic, the most dea…
